Output 98d80a89462b804ffeb074c1800d0ff7f9bf94c1b783626d3bcec446b9a10959:13

value
850000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2af20512bd70e76aed65a48940bfec38df06534d478d33a7da8fbd98141a249a
address
tb1p9teq2y4awrnk4mt95jy5p0lv8r0sv56dg7xn8f76377es9q6yjdqmk2pnl
transaction
98d80a89462b804ffeb074c1800d0ff7f9bf94c1b783626d3bcec446b9a10959
confirmations
10746
spent
true